예제 #1
0
def keypress(event):
    global pos,cb,fig,dataset,nticks,ticks,colors,cmap
    if event.key==",":
        pos -= 1
    if event.key==".":
        pos += 10
    if event.key=="a":
        nticks+=1
        ticks=[i/float(nticks) for i in range(nticks)]
        colors=[float2rgb(sqrt(i+1),mic,mxc) for i in range(len(ticks))]
    if event.key=="z":
        nticks-=1
        ticks=[i/float(nticks) for i in range(nticks)]
        colors=[float2rgb(sqrt(i+1),mic,mxc) for i in range(len(ticks))]
    pos=pos%gridsz[0]
    if pstyle==1:
        ax=logplotter(X,Y,dataset[pos,:,:],ticks,colors)
        pl.title("%d Log plot energy density, use < and > to change plots"%pos)
        #P.colorbar(ax,ticks=ticks,drawedges=True)
        cb.update_bruteforce(ax)
    elif pstyle==2:
        plotter(X,Y,dataset[pos,:,:])
        pl.title("%d Vacancy in Red, use < and > to change plots"%pos)
    elif pstyle==3:
        pl.imshow(dataset[pos,:,:],extent=[0,gridsz[0],0,gridsz[1]],cmap=cmap)
    pl.draw()
